# Break-Glass: Catalog Cache Invalidation

Scope: the Pinrow product catalog at Veldstone Retail. If stale prices persist after a purge and the Hollowmere invalidation queue is wedged, use break-glass to flush the edge tier directly. Contractors: get verbal sign-off from the catalog lead first. Steps: open the Hollowmere admin shell, select emergency-flush, confirm the tenant, and run it once — repeated flushes thrash the origin. Access is logged and expires after 20 minutes. Unseal the admin shell with the passphrase below.

recovery phrase for kahop-tajog: istix-casvan

Handing off the FareSplit ticket-pricing experiment while I'm out. Variant B (dynamic weekend pricing) is live at 20% traffic; variant A is control. If customers write in confused about prices changing between sessions, that's expected — just tag the ticket with the experiment label so we can count them. Don't refund unless the charge actually mismatches the confirmation screen. The FAQ, rollback steps, and current variant split are all kept on the page below.

dashboard of fajop-badug = https://jira.qorvelsys.internal/pages/pages/pages/display

**Q: How do we run schema migrations on Lanternbase without downtime?**

A: Always follow the expand-contract pattern: add the new column first, dual-write from the application, backfill in batches of 5,000 rows, then remove the old column in a later release. Never combine expand and contract in one deploy. The Drelmont migration runner enforces lock timeouts of two seconds, so long-held locks abort safely. The full step-by-step checklist, including rollback guidance, lives on our internal page.

runbook for badug-kadup: https://confluence.zemvarlabs.internal/projects/browse/display/projects/bd1b

## Soft Deletes in Orders

The Cartwheel platform never hard-deletes rows from the `orders` table. Instead, a `deleted_at` timestamp is set, and all plugin queries must filter on it being null. Helper views handle this automatically if you use the `orders_live` view. To test your plugin against realistic data, connect using the string below.

database URL for haduf-tajof: redis://holox_svc:c9@db-3fb6.lumicworks.local:5432/fraeth